Author Spotlight - Sandra Harris



Born in the far north of Australia, yearly cyclones, floods and being cut off from civilization for weeks at a time were the norm. An outrageous imagination helped occupy Sandra’s mind.

An abiding interest in astronomy and a deep-seated need to always see the good guys win naturally influences her writing. Not satisfied with the amount of romance in science fiction novels she set out to redress the balance.

She currently lives in sunny South East Queensland, Australia, with her husband and Cavalier King Charles Spaniel, who doesn’t seem to realize she comes from royalty and should act in a more appropriate manner.

Author Spotlight - Kathy Bosman

Ubuntu is a new line of romance novels from Decadent Publishing - a line of books set in Africa and featuring African characters. One of the line's launch titles, Dragonfly Moments by South African author Kathy Bosman, is in our spotlight today.

Kathy has appeared in our Spotlight before, talking about her debut novel Wedding Gown Girl, so today's interview will be a little shorter than usual.

1. Do you write every day?
I wish, I wish, and I wish. Lately, it’s been really hard as I have two more books coming out this year so I’ve worn the editing hat quite a bit. Life’s demands squeeze out my time but on some of my good days, I make up for the bad ones. Note some, not all.

2. Which blog(s) do you read regularly?
I read the Minxy blog and some author friends’ blogs as well as The Bookshelf Muse. They have some wonderful writing tips. That’s not all. I read about ten other blogs on other topics I’m interested in, so yes, my blog reader software on my phone keeps quite busy.

3. Keeping fit: Do you have an exercise regime to counterbalance all those hours sitting at a computer?
I have got a little lazy in this regard. I used to run 10 km races but nowadays prefer walking. Twice a week, I do my exercise DVDs which are a mix of dance moves, weights, and general exercise. Once a week, I go on my much-needed jog / walk where I get lots of writing inspiration. My kids rope me into playing soccer or hockey sometimes but lately, I lose everything as they get older and stronger. I was never good at sport but do really enjoy it.

4. Just for fun: a year from the end of the book, where would your couple go on holiday?
Ryan loves safari so they would probably go to Kruger National Park and go on game drives and a few walks or maybe God’s Window in Mpumalanga so Tessa can sketch the mountains and scenery. The place they stay at would have to offer top-class cuisine to match Ryan’s taste being a chef.

5. Could you be friends with any of your heroines?
I would probably find all my heroines fun to be friends with. They all have a little bit of me in them but also elements that are so different to me. I’m trying to learn the importance of making female characters who are kind yet not wimpish. It’s a hard balance to reach but it makes them likeable—to me at least. I think my favourites so far have been Kienna and Elaine. Kienna is from “Wedding Gown Girl” and Elaine is from a book I have coming out in September called “Three Tiers for Win.”

6. Have you ever written a hero you'd be happy to run off with?
I love all my heroes but I suppose Ryan from Dragonfly Moments and Win are my favourites. Win is super hot being an Olympic swimmer yet has some dark secrets which make him mysterious. Despite that, he’s a great love for his lady. Ryan has the patience of a saint and I love his rugged look. His looks are based a little on my hubby’s looks.

Sinfully Summer - guest post by Aimee Duffy


Why did I choose Marbella as the location for Sinfully Summer? Well, for me there’s nothing like a good beach holiday with the girls. Sizzling myself on the beach all day, downing some cocktails late in the afternoon, and then dancing the night away is my favourite kind of vacation.

Since I’m in the UK, it’s so much easier to travel to Spain (I hate long flights). I’ve visited most of the country, and I have to say that’s not just because it’s easier to get to. Portugal’s closer after all. Nope, me and my girlies visit for the local men. Spain literally has it all, clubs, bars, waterparks and lush eye candy. What more can a girl ask for?

So when I was brainstorming locations for Sinfully Summer, I couldn’t pass Spain up. Marbella is the playground for the rich and famous (including an Arabian princess). Top that off with a rare European micro-climate which means it’s scorchio for 300 days a year, a long list of beach bars and clubs to rival some of Europe’s most prestigious party spots and I have the perfect place for a scandalous story.

Plus, with all the tales of the Marbella-based debauchery, my notoriously wild heiress and her best friends would fit right in. Well, until stick-up-his-ass Enrique tries to tame her, that is. Yeah, good luck with that Ric…








So why not jump on a plane and go visit the party central of Spain? If you can’t make it, you can always pick up Sinfully Summer and live voraciously through my heroine.

I really didn’t get up to all the things she does, or partake in crazy dares that left me running around a hotel in my underwear. Neither did any of my friends. Plus we’d never sunbathe topless, pull a gay guy, or do anything else those three get up to. Honest.
